The Oregon Board of Licensed Professional Counselors and Therapists sets education, experience and examination standards and a Code of Ethics for licensed professional counselors and licensed marriage and family therapists.

When your renewal time approaches, we will send you a renewal packet including a renewal code. Sign in to the renewal system with your renewal code, complete the renewal form, and pay for your renewal online (using VISA or Mastercard).
